What are some examples of racist scenes in 'A Christmas Story'?

2 answers
2024-12-09 16:15

There really aren't any racist scenes in 'A Christmas Story' that I'm aware of. The movie is centered around Ralphie's quest for a Red Ryder BB gun and his interactions with his family, schoolmates, and the local community. It's a nostalgic look at Christmas in a bygone era, with no elements of racism that are prominent or part of the story's fabric.

Does every Christmas have a story? What are some examples?

1 answer
2024-11-09 02:08

Sure. There are many Christmas stories. Take the Nativity story which is central to the Christian celebration of Christmas. It tells of the birth of Jesus in Bethlehem. And then there are fictional stories like 'A Christmas Carol' by Charles Dickens. This story shows how Ebenezer Scrooge changes his miserly ways after being visited by ghosts on Christmas Eve. It reflects on the spirit of Christmas which is about kindness, giving, and family.
